groundsel

Pronunciation: /ˈgraʊn(d)s(ə)l/
Definition of groundsel

noun

  • a widely distributed plant of the daisy family, with yellow rayless flowers.
    • Genus Senecio, family Compositae: several species, in particular the common groundsel (S. vulgaris), which is a common weed

Origin:

Old English gundæswelgiæ (later grundeswylige), probably from gund 'pus' + swelgan 'to swallow' (with reference to its use in poultices). The later form may be by association with ground1, and refer to the plant's rapid growth
